Adalah sukar bagi pengguna Linux baru untuk memantau nama pengguna atau kumpulan dengan Id / Gid mereka. Dalam pengedaran Linux, sebuah ID adalah alat baris perintah yang digunakan untuk memaparkan Id pengguna dan Id kumpulan yang sebenar dan berkesan.
Id sebenar adalah yang memiliki sistem; ia menunjukkan kepada anda jika anda pemilik akaun. Id berkesan serupa dengan Id sebenar tetapi dengan beberapa batasan.
Anda tidak perlu memuat turun atau memasang id utiliti arahan, kerana ia adalah alat bawaan dalam sistem seperti Linux.
Sintaks Perintah Id
id [Pilihan]… [Nama Pengguna]
Perintah Id
Untuk memaparkan identiti anda sendiri, ketik ID di terminal. ID akan memaparkan id anda, id kumpulan utama, dan id kumpulan tambahan jika ada.
$ id
Id Perintah dengan Pilihan
Berikut adalah beberapa pilihan untuk menunjukkan cara kerja ID utiliti arahan.
Mari kita mulakan:
1. Untuk mendapatkan id pengguna tertentu, gunakan "-UPilihan.
$ id -u warda
2. "-g"Mewakili kumpulan, jadi jika anda ingin menampilkan GID tertentu, gunakan pilihan ini di terminal:
$ id -g warda
3. Untuk memaparkan semua id kumpulan pengguna, "-G"Pilihan akan digunakan:
$ id -G warda
4. BantuanPilihan digunakan untuk mencetak dokumen bantuan di terminal untuk panduan dan kemudian keluar.
$ id --bantuan
Beberapa pilihan lain disenaraikan di bawah yang boleh digunakan apabila diperlukan:
-Z: Untuk menampilkan pertandingan keselamatan
-r: Untuk memaparkan id sebenar
-z: Untuk membatasi entri melalui aksara Null
-n: Untuk memaparkan nama dan bukannya nombor
Sekarang, mari kita periksa cara mencetak nama dan bukannya nombor menggunakan -n pilihan.
Sebagai contoh, jika saya ingin mencetak nama semua kumpulan yang menjadi milik pengguna dan bukannya id mereka, saya akan menggunakan arahan berikut:
$ id -n -G warda
Di sini anda dapat melihat, ia mencetak nama semua kumpulan.
Begitu juga, anda boleh menggunakan "-ng" untuk nama kumpulan sebenar dan "-nu" untuk nama pengguna.
Anda boleh menggunakan perintah "-r" dengan -awak, -g, dan -G pilihan untuk memaparkan id sebenar dan bukannya id berkesan di terminal.
Sebagai contoh, laksanakan perintah berikut untuk mendapatkan id sebenar kumpulan, ketik:
$ id -r -g
Seperti yang anda lihat, kita boleh mendapatkan id sebenar dengan dan tanpa arahan nama pengguna.
Kami akan mendapat hasil yang sama.
Mari lihat contoh lain:
$ id -r -G
Anda juga boleh mendapatkan maklumat pengguna tertentu:
$ id warda
Kesimpulannya
Kami telah belajar dari tutorial ini bagaimana menggunakan "ID"Perintah untuk ID sebenar dan berkesan. The "ID"Perintah digunakan untuk mencetak identiti pengguna, id kumpulan tertentu, dan semua id kumpulan yang menjadi milik pengguna. Kami juga telah memeriksa pelbagai pilihan arahan Id dan fungsi mereka.